Members and visitors are required to adhere to the Club dress code. Members are responsible for ensuring their guests comply.
In the Clubhouse ...
Dress in the clubhouse should at all times be neat and tidy, and suitable for the occasion. Jeans may be worn if they are clean, neat and not “distressed”.
Likewise, trainers, if worn, must be clean and respectable.
The following are not allowed in the bar and restaurant area:
Golf shoes, sleeveless and sloganned T-shirts, caps and golf hats, wet weather gear or muddy garments etc; replica sports kit e.g. rugby shirts.
It is expected that members and guests should not wear the same clothes they have played in when attending post match presentations unless otherwise specified by the Captain.
On the Golf Course ...
Members, their guests and visitors are expected to dress in smart golf clothing. Tailored shorts may be worn with sports socks and shirts should have collars unless specifically designed for golf. Shirts should always be tucked in.
Golf shoes must be worn on the course at all times.
Jeans are not permitted on the golf course.
